How to prevent ants from invading your living room carpet

The best way to get rid of ants is to prevent them from entering your living room carpet in the first place. Keep your living room clean and free of food crumbs, which can attract ants. Seal any cracks or openings in your walls or floors, as ants can easily find their way inside. You can also use a barrier of natural ant repellents, such as cinnamon or peppermint, around the perimeter of your living room to deter ants from entering.

DIY ant traps for living room carpet

If you already have ants in your living room, try making your own ant traps using simple household ingredients. For example, mix equal parts baking soda and powdered sugar and place it in a shallow dish near where the ants are entering. The ants will be attracted to the sugar, but the baking soda will kill them. You can also mix borax with honey or corn syrup to create a homemade ant bait.

Using essential oils to repel ants from living room carpet

Many essential oils have natural ant-repelling properties and can be a safe and effective way to get rid of ants in your living room carpet. Some of the most effective essential oils for repelling ants include peppermint, lemon, eucalyptus, and tea tree. Simply mix a few drops of your chosen essential oil with water and spray it around the perimeter of your living room or on areas where ants are present.

Why ants are attracted to living room carpet and how to stop it

Ants are attracted to living room carpets for a few reasons. One, they are searching for food, and crumbs or spills on your carpet can provide a tempting feast for them. Two, ants are also drawn to the warmth and moisture of carpets, making them a prime spot for nesting. To prevent ants from being attracted to your living room carpet, make sure to keep it clean and dry. Consider using a dehumidifier if your living room tends to be humid.

Natural ant repellents for living room carpet

In addition to essential oils, there are other natural ant repellents that you can use to keep ants out of your living room carpet. These include diatomaceous earth, which is a fine powder made from fossilized algae that is harmless to humans and pets but deadly to ants. You can also try sprinkling coffee grounds, citrus peels, or cucumber slices around the perimeter of your living room to deter ants.

Tips for keeping ants out of your living room carpet

Aside from regular cleaning and using natural repellents, there are a few other tips you can follow to keep ants out of your living room carpet. Keep all food, including pet food, stored in airtight containers. Wipe down counters and floors after cooking or eating. Fix any plumbing leaks to prevent excess moisture. And regularly vacuum your living room carpet to remove any potential food sources for ants.
